About Nicole Causey

Nicole Causey is a distinguished real estate professional whose approach prioritizes service over sales. Renowned for her ethics, integrity, and exceptional communication skills, she has cultivated a loyal clientele that consistently seeks her expertise.

Originally from Canada, Nicole moved to Fremont at the age of ten. While pursuing her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, she gained valuable experience in retail, eventually rising to the role of Business Account Manager. A pivotal moment in her career occurred when a chance meeting with a friend led her to interview with a prominent local real estate agent.

This opportunity proved transformative, as it equipped Nicole with comprehensive knowledge in prospecting, marketing, and negotiation. Overseeing more than 200 home sales provided her with an invaluable education in the real estate sector. In 2004, armed with her refined customer service skills and newfound expertise, she obtained her real estate license and has dedicated herself to the field ever since.

Nicole's relentless work ethic and intrinsic motivation have propelled her to significant success. She has been recognized as a Pinnacle Agent by the Bay East Association of Realtors® annually since 2011 and achieved the distinction of being the second-ranked agent out of 34,000 nationwide at her previous brokerage. For Nicole, these accolades reflect her genuine passion for enhancing her clients' lives through homeownership.

Outside of her professional endeavors, Nicole enjoys traveling, reading, home renovations, interior design, and wine tasting. She cherishes time spent with her family and is an animal lover, caring for a dog, two cats, and backyard chickens. Committed to giving back, she serves on the Board of Directors for SAVE, an organization supporting domestic violence victims in the Tri-City area, and volunteers with Adopt an Angel, which provides holiday gifts for children in protective services and foster care in the East Bay.

Major Alameda County, California Real Estate Markets

Oakland dominates as the county's largest market, where neighborhoods like Rockridge and Piedmont command premium prices while areas such as West Oakland undergo rapid gentrification driven by proximity to San Francisco and BART accessibility. Fremont and Union City anchor the southern corridor, attracting tech workers and families seeking newer construction and highly-rated schools, while Dublin and Pleasanton represent some of the Bay Area's fastest-appreciating suburban markets.

Berkeley's unique position as a university town creates distinct rental and investment opportunities, particularly in the Southside and Downtown districts, while smaller communities like Albany and Emeryville offer niche markets with their own specialized demand patterns. The Tri-Valley region, encompassing Livermore and Dublin, has emerged as a surprising hotspot for both residential growth and commercial development, driven by excellent transportation links and relative affordability compared to Peninsula alternatives.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Alameda County's real estate market operates on multiple economic engines simultaneously, from Oakland's port-driven commercial sector to the residential boom fueled by tech industry displacement from San Francisco and Silicon Valley. The county experiences some of the Bay Area's most dramatic price variations, where properties in Castro Valley might sell for half the price of comparable homes just fifteen minutes away in Piedmont, creating both opportunities and challenges for agents and investors.

Geographic barriers like the Berkeley Hills and San Francisco Bay create distinct micro-climates and commute patterns that significantly impact property values and buyer preferences. The recent surge in remote work has particularly benefited eastern communities like Livermore and Castro Valley, where buyers discover they can access larger properties and better value while maintaining reasonable access to urban employment centers through BART and highway connections.
